It is an inner ear disorder characterized by problems in the structures that provide balance in the inner ear. Meniere's disease The main symptoms include recurrent attacks of dizziness and hearing loss. It usually occurs unilaterally and can come and go in attacks. The disease is associated with an imbalance of fluid pressure in the inner ear or changes in the chemical structure of the fluid.

What are the symptoms of Meniere's disease?

What is Meniere's Disease?Meniere's disease Sudden and severe attacks of dizziness may occur during the attack. The patient usually feels as if they are spinning around. Hearing loss usually begins unilaterally and may be progressive. Hearing may be normal between attacks at the beginning. Sounds such as ringing, buzzing or humming may be heard in the ear.

There may be a feeling of fullness or pressure in the ear. Nausea and vomiting may occur during severe dizziness attacks. Meniere's disease symptoms usually occur in attacks. Symptoms may ease or disappear temporarily between attacks. The severity and frequency of the disease may vary from person to person.

How Is Meniere's Disease Diagnosed?

The doctor takes a detailed history of the patient's symptoms and performs a physical exam. This helps evaluate symptoms such as hearing loss, tinnitus, and balance problems. The patient's hearing ability is evaluated with audiological tests. Tests usually include audiograms and tympanometry. The doctor may perform vestibular tests to evaluate balance problems. Tests include the Romberg test and other specialized balance tests.

Meniere's disease Imaging tests (such as an MRI) are usually not needed to make a diagnosis. However, if the symptoms are interpreted as a sign of another problem, the doctor will order these tests. There are no specific laboratory tests to diagnose the disease. Some blood tests or other laboratory tests are needed to rule out other possible causes. Diagnosis is usually based on a combination of symptoms and signs. It may require ruling out other possible causes. Therefore, it is important to consult an otolaryngologist for a correct diagnosis.

What are the Treatment Methods for Meniere's Disease?

What is Meniere's Disease?Medications to relieve dizziness and other symptoms play an important role in managing the disease. Anti-vertigo medications, antihistamines, and diuretics are some common options. Limiting salt intake can reduce the severity of symptoms by reducing the pressure in the inner ear. In some cases, doctors may recommend salt restriction. For patients with hearing loss, auditory rehabilitation therapy, hearing aids, and other solutions can provide auditory support.

Infusion treatments, which involve delivering medication directly to the inner ear, may help control symptoms. Meniere's disease In advanced cases, surgical options are considered to reduce hearing loss. Procedures such as endolymphatic drainage or vestibular nerve cutting may be used for this purpose. Some patients may benefit from alternative medicine methods such as acupuncture. However, there is limited definitive evidence about the effectiveness of such treatments. The appropriate method of treatment should be determined based on the patient's symptoms and the severity of the disease. Therefore, the treatment plan should be customized for each patient.
